Seymour, Victoria
Seymour is a town in the state of Victoria, Australia. 97 kilometres North of Melbourne, it was established in 1839 at the crossing of the Goulburn river on the Melbourne-Sydney route where an inn was first built. The railway arrived in 1872 along with substantial infrastructure to support it. Its population of 7000 people service the nearby military base of Puckapunyal and the surrounding agricultural industries, primarily sheep, cattle and wine production.
